SYDNEY, N.S. — Ivan Ivan scored with 1:16 left in overtime to lift the Cape Breton Eagles to a 3-2 win over the Charlottetown Islanders in Quebec Major Junior Hockey League action Wednesday.
The teams were tied after a scoreless third period in front of 2,245 fans at Centre 200. Shaun Miller finished with a goal and an assist, while Nathan Larose added a single.
For the Islanders, Nikita Alexandrov scored both tallies, including a power-play marker in the first period.
In goal, Kevin Mandolese made 30 saves for the win to improve his record to 5-1-0-0 on the season. Matthew Welsh stopped 27 shots as he fell to 5-1-2-0.
The win improved Cape Breton’s record to 8-3-0-0 for 16 points, one back of the Islanders (7-1-3-0) for top spot in the Eastern Conference.
Cape Breton returns to the ice Friday when they host the Halifax Mooseheads (7-4-0-0) at Centre 200, a 7 p.m. start.
